Your source for everything New York Islanders. Hosts Alex and Steve fill you in on the latest on the ice and off the ice news from Long Island's only major sports team.

Hockey Night on Long Island's fourteenth episode was another extremely informative and entertaining one. Steve and I analyzed the two latest signings by the Islanders, discussed the team's new ECHL affiliate, talked Smyth and Blake and Yashin, and took callers and IMs from some very knowledgeable listeners.
In bonus coverage, we took our sights off of the Islanders and made our Stanley Cup previews and predictions and discussed the top ranked prospects in the upcoming NHL Draft. If you did catch this, you got to hear me "pull a Chris Russo" and butcher some name pronunciations.
While on the subject of the NHL Draft, be sure to tune in next Saturday, June 2nd, at 3 PM EST for a very special guest. We will be joined by Matt Ebbs of International Scouting Services (ISS). Matt, who is the General Manager at ISS, will inform us all about the latest methods of hockey scouting and let us know who might be wearing Orange and Blue when draft weekend rolls around. To top it all off, Mr. Ebbs will take questions from callers and IMers. Be sure to tune in on Saturday, June 2nd at 3PM, for this extremely special episode.
